The coaching process

The typical coaching engagement begins with a no-obligation consultation where we seek to understand your personal and professional goals and aspirations. We then discuss the results you are looking to achieve as a result of the executive coaching relationship.

If the consultation reveals we may be a good match, we move to the assessment phase. We have access to a variety of tools that will help you gain insights on your life, your work, your strengths and opportunities for future growth. Where appropriate, the assessment may include confidential interviews with others in your organization to gain additional perspective.

Following the assessment, we move to the engagement phase. That may take the form of an initial term from three to 12 months and weekly or biweekly one-on-one meetings, depending on your needs and budget. 

What are the meetings like?

As the client, you accept responsibility for scheduling regular meetings through our virtual platform and being prepared and fully present for each session. We typically plan for one-hour virtual meetings and focus them squarely on the results you wish to achieve in each session. You can expect to receive constructive, yet pointed questions intended to help you navigate the increasingly complex situations leaders face in organizations today.
